Route & Timing
The run holds US-59/I-69 north through Splendora and Cleveland into the East Texas pine forest, with Lufkin sitting just under two hours out. Tyler’s LD crew loads the Kingwood curb early, and most one-to-three-bedroom households unload the same afternoon.
What This Move Costs
| Home size | Typical range |
|---|---|
| Studio / 1BR apartment | $2,695–$3,995 |
| 2BR apartment | $3,995–$5,795 |
| 3BR home / apartment + garage | $5,795–$7,595 |
| 4BR home + piano + storage | $7,595–$8,800 |
All Kingwood to Lufkin moves are binding flat figures — Grant signs after Miles’s walkthrough. Piano work adds $395; full-pack adds a Saturday.
